Airbus Helicopters and Babcock announce that they have been awarded a 12-year contract by the Direction de la Maintenance Aéronautique, starting this year, to support 48 EC145 helicopters operated by the French Ministry of the Interior.

The contract covers 33 Civil Security and 15 Gendarmerie helicopters at 41 bases. It covers technical support, the supply of spare parts, logistics solutions, technical data management and software support.

The aircraft in question are used for search and rescue, emergency medical services and fire-fighting missions, while those of the Gendarmerie are also engaged in law enforcement operations.
